Career path

Career Role in Agroecological Stewardship & Leadership (UK) Description
Agroecology Consultant Provides expert advice on sustainable farming practices to businesses and organizations, driving the adoption of agroecological principles. High demand for expertise in regenerative agriculture and soil health.
Sustainable Agriculture Manager Manages and oversees the implementation of agroecological methods on farms and estates. Strong leadership and project management skills crucial for operational efficiency and environmental impact measurement.
Agroecological Researcher Conducts research and data analysis in support of agroecological practices. Contributes to the development of innovative techniques and sustainable solutions for food production.
Policy Advisor in Agroecology Develops and advocates for policies that promote agroecological transitions within the UK's agricultural sector. Requires strong policy, communication and advocacy skills.
Agroecological Educator/Trainer Educates and trains farmers, students, and the public on the principles and practices of agroecology. Excellent communication and teaching skills are essential to disseminate knowledge.
